    Default Leaking front forks

    Front forks on 1800 goldwing champion trike are leaking. Thinking about putting progressive mono tube suspension in. Has anyone done this or heard of it being done? If so how is it working?

    Doug, welcome to Trike Talk from West Virginia.

    I lifted this information from Wing Stuff.

    If your fork tubes are not worn, and springs still support the trike, just do a complete rebuild to what you have. If forks compress more than 2"-2 1/2" from fully extended to static without riders, springs may need replacing.

    Default Fork seals

    Had good talk with Progressive about putting Mono tubes in forks. Rep said he would not recommend mono tubes in racked front in. Seeing how I already have Progressive springs and bike is only settling 1-1/2 inch he recommended rebuild forks put the springs I already have back in and using 15 weight shock oil. and let him know if that helps

    We have a 2004 GL1800 trike. With the rake conversion on most trikes the guards over the tubes are taken off and dust grit and even bugs can get on the fork tubes and work their way under the seals. Had a leaking fork seal and made my own cleaner from a plastic milk bottle. Cleaned the seal, a bit of fluid came out so I wiped it up with a rag, bounced the front end a few times to seat the seals, went for a ride and all has been fine for 4000 miles.

    Link to a How-To video:

    Cost: 1 quart of milk in a plastic bottle. A gallon bottle will make a larger cleaner. Back through the mist of time we did this with a piece of 35mm film. Hard to find in these digital times,

    I always find thus topic very interesting to read because of the varied responses.

    First, when I triked and talking to several installers about the front suspension on 1800 Gold Wings the responses were:

    One told me he insisted on Progressive springs on the first 6 installs he did. After 5 of the 6 came back asking for the OEM springs to be reinstalled, he quick insisting and advised those that wanted Progressive to just install new OEM.

    I too asked Progressive about Mono tubes and was advised there would be no warranty if installed on a trike and there was no plans to make any that would function on a trike!

    Fork springs do wear out. I have replaced mine at 20,000 mile intervals with very good results. OEMs are not that expensive!

    Have another question You guys that are putting factory springs back in front forks How much sag are you getting. By this I mean the distance between when the bike is setting mark the top of seal then jack the bike up until tire is off ground measure this distance between top of seal. distance should not be more then 2". Total travel distance in fork is about 5 to 6" add your weight and you are down to 3" when you hit a bump. Not much to keep it from bottoming out.

    I am also using 36-38lbs psi on my front tire but have Ptogressive springs. I dont find them to be rough at all. I would describe a firm feel but not rough. When I was running 41lbs psi on front tire, I would definitely say it was rough but by lowering pressure, no problems. I'm wondering if those complaining of the rough ride with Progressive springs are also running at 41lbs and are possibly dealing with anti dive valve issues. I disabled mine like was mentioned over and over after putting in the Progressives. Since a trike already has several hundred pounds of added weight, I like the idea of having upgrades springs. Even though OEM springs are cheaper, if you are replacing them every 20,000 or so miles, you will end up spending way more than just buying and using upgraded springs. My choice was Progressives but some have used Traxxion springs and there are others out there that would also fit the bill.

    So tore front forks apart and to my surprise no progressive springs (Trike builder said he put them in ) What was in there was a 2" extension at the top a 6"spacer and a 12 spring (probably stock ) So ordered progressive springs which is 18". So I guess the the 6" spacer goes away. waiting for springs and instruction.
